How to Get Replacement Car Keys: A Comprehensive Guide
Losing a car key can be a frustrating and stressful experience. Car keys are essential for accessing and starting your vehicle. Luckily, there are several methods to acquire a replacement set of car keys. This short article explores the various techniques car owners can employ to replace their lost keys, consisting of expenses, pointers for avoidance, and commonly asked concerns.
Kinds Of Car Keys
Before talking about replacement options, it's essential to know the various kinds of car keys readily available today. Comprehending the type of key you have can streamline the replacement procedure.
Type of KeyDescriptionStandard KeyA standard metal key without any electronic elements.Transponder KeyA key ingrained with a chip that communicates with the car's engine.Smart KeyA keyless entry system that permits remote operation of the vehicle.Key FobA remote device that typically includes locking/unlocking functions.How to Replace Your Car Keys
There are several methods to replace lost or damaged car keys, each with its special procedure and associated expenses.
1. Calling Your Dealership
If the lost key is a clever key or transponder key, contacting your car dealership is often the most reputable approach. They have the essential devices and competence to produce a new key particular to your vehicle design.
Process:
Gather your vehicle info (make, model, year, VIN).Visit or call the dealer for instructions.They will need proof of ownership, such as the car title or registration.Some key fob replacements might require to be configured on-site.
Approximated Costs:
Traditional or fundamental keys: ₤ 50 - ₤ 100Transponder keys: ₤ 150 - ₤ 250Smart keys: ₤ 200 - ₤ 5002. Utilizing a Locksmith
Locksmiths can often offer a quicker and more affordable alternative to dealers, particularly for standard keys or easy transponder keys.
Process:
Find a regional locksmith professional with proficiency in automotive keys.Program evidence of ownership.The locksmith can cut a new key and may be able to set a transponder key also.
Estimated Costs:
Traditional keys: ₤ 5 - ₤ 20Transponder keys: ₤ 50 - ₤ 150Smart keys: ₤ 100 - ₤ 3003. Ordering Online
Lots of online merchants use key replacement services. You can frequently find blanks that can be cut and configured to fit your vehicle.
Process:
Search for a reputable online key retailer.Order a replacement key based on your vehicle's key type and VIN.Follow return or programming guidelines provided by the seller.
Approximated Costs:
Typically lower than dealer costs, ranging from ₤ 20 - ₤ 100, however programming expenses might still apply.4. Using Key Replacement Services
Some business specialize in car key replacements and may use mobile services that come to you. This alternative can be particularly convenient.
Process:
Research key replacement services in your location.Call for a quote and inquire about mobile services.Depending on the company, they might require evidence of ownership.
Approximated Costs:
Similar to locksmiths, usually in between ₤ 50 - ₤ 300, depending upon the key type.How to Prevent Key Loss in the Future
While losing a key can take place to anyone, there are steps that car owners can take to reduce the risk.

A1: Yes, a lot of car dealerships and locksmiths can develop a replacement key using your vehicle recognition number (VIN) and proof of ownership.
Q2: How long does it require to get a replacement key?
A2: The time can differ based upon the approach you choose. Car dealerships might take longer due to configuring requirements, while locksmith professionals and online services may supply quicker options.
Q3: Is it safe to use online services for replacement keys?
A3: While numerous online sellers use genuine key replacements, it's vital to research the seller to ensure they are respectable.
Q4: What if my key is broken instead of lost?
A4: A locksmith or car dealership can frequently help you produce a brand-new key based on the broken one, so bring it along if possible.
